Originally Posted by jason1384
How do you know which ones are the front? I got a P0420 and P0430 code.

P0430 Catalyst System Efficiency Below Threshold (Bank 2)

P0420 Catalyst System Efficiency Below Threshold (Bank 1)
Those two codes are for the catalytic converters, the rear o2's have sensed that the performance of your cats is below acceptable. You could have just squeaked by emissions testing before your cats were bad enough to throw a code.
